Quote from: nocomply on November 29, 2010, 08:43:26 AM
Quote from: O on November 28, 2010, 10:58:01 AM
I took this bike through South America for some 10,000km over 4 months back when I was 18.?
Check the sandstorm brewing in the background.
on a 125cc 4-stroke?! That's impressive.
It was actually a 150cc, that battery cover plate is a replacement as is the gas tank; I got hit by another motorist from the side at like 100km/hr.
Terrifying shit, the gas tank exploded and I couldn't walk for like 4 days because I landed on my tailbone.
The other guy broke his shoulder blade and completely fucked up his face, fucking idiot.
I'm not fluent in Spanish either so I ended up getting most of the blame, being a gringo and all.
Corrupt fucking cops in small town Peru, they put me in a cell for the night until the guy who's hostel I was staying in came over with his Peruvian friend to get me out. It was right on the border with Ecuador and the only other person in there was a female drug mule who was like crying most of the time and then going ape shit at the cops any time they'd offer her food or water.
Anyway, crazy days. Fully worth it though.
